Wednesday, September 29, 2004
The prosaically named Space Ship One, which became the first private manned spaceship earlier this summer, will attempt to claim the $10 million dollar Ansari X-Prize starting today. To do that, you have to carry three humans (or a pilot and the equivalent weight of two humans) 62.1 miles high twice in two weeks.
